Lead Teller
Job Description
Summary:
Assists the Assistant Branch Manager and/or Branch Manager with managing the daily workflow of the teller area. Balances the vault daily and maintains cash limits. Performs branch audits including researching teller differences. Is the expert in the technology, policies, and procedures used by the teller staff. Leads teller area to make sure daily items are completed and are accurate.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
Assists branch management with overall daily workflow of tellers including working a teller drawer
Act as the teller first contact and can answer general questions about technology, policies, and procedures
Leads teller area to make sure daily items are completed and accurate
Manages cash vault and cash limits
Orders or ships cash as needed
Audits teller drawers, cashier’s checks & Money Orders
Audits teller due to differences, responsible to try to locate difference, as needed
Balances ATM
Performs essential duties and responsibilities of a teller
Assists branch manager in quarterly unit assessment
Participates in opening and closing the branch, following procedures set by corporate security
Other duties as assigned
